🌿 Quick Facts

Category Details
Botanical Name Plinia sp. ‘Escarlate’ (Scarlet Jaboticaba)
Sale Size Ships in a 1-gallon container (juvenile tree, well-developed canopy)
Approximate Age 2 – 3 years old
Mature Size 20–30 ft in-ground unpruned • 6–12 ft pruned and container-grown
USDA Zones 9 – 11 outdoors • Greenhouse or sunroom for cooler climates
Light Filtered or dappled light preferred when young • Full sun possible for mature trees with consistent moisture
Cold Tolerance Tolerates short dips to 27–29 °F once mature • Protect young plants from frost
Soil Moist, rich, slightly acidic (pH 5.5–6.5) • Must be well-draining
Growth Habit Slow-growing in youth, upright, compact, and cauliflorous (fruits on trunk and limbs)
Spacing 10–20 ft in-ground • Closer for container plantings
Foliage Type Evergreen to semi-evergreen in Florida • Minor leaf drop after stress or cold spells is normal

🍈 Fruit & Fruiting

  • Flavor Profile: Sweet and rich with a hint of tropical tang — like a muscadine grape with a delicate twist of lychee.
  • Texture: Juicy, translucent pulp wrapped in a thin, tender purple skin.
  • Display: The fruit grows in dense clusters directly on the trunk and older branches, creating a living sculpture.
  • Seasonality (Florida): Multiple flushes per year in warm, humid conditions, peaking in spring and summer.
  • Fruiting Timeline: The fastest-fruiting jaboticaba in our collection, typically beginning to flower and fruit within 2–4 years from this size under ideal conditions.

🌾 Why We Recommend Containers

While jaboticabas can fruit in the ground, we find they perform best in containers, where we can control drainage, moisture, and soil pH.

  • Preferred Mix: 50 % perlite / 50 % peat moss — light, acidic, and moisture-stable.
  • Watering: Daily watering or drip irrigation is ideal; do not allow to dry out.
  • Light: Filtered light for young plants; full sun only after gradual acclimation.
  • Our Observation: Filtered or dappled light produces the healthiest foliage at our nursery. Mature trees in full sun (like those in South Florida’s Herb & Spice Park) fruit beautifully when properly irrigated.

🌞 Light & Climate Guidelines

  • Young Trees (2–4 yrs): Thrive in filtered or bright partial shade; avoid intense afternoon sun.
  • Mature Trees (5+ yrs): Can thrive in full sun with consistent moisture.
  • Hot, Dry Conditions: Provide afternoon shade and humidity.
  • Cold Events: Protect below 30 °F; cover or move to shelter.

Site Selection & Landscape Use

  • Florida (Zones 9–11): Perfect in large containers or rich, organic garden beds with steady irrigation.
  • Cooler Regions: Grow in containers that can be moved indoors or to a greenhouse during winter.
  • Design Tip: The Scarlet Jaboticaba’s smooth bark, glossy leaves, and cauliflorous fruit make it a showpiece — even when not in fruit.

🪴 Container & Indoor Growing

  • Step-Up Plan: 1 G → 3 G → 7 G → 15–30 G as roots fill the pot (larger sizes for pickup only).
  • Soil Mix: Use 50/50 perlite and peat moss for best root aeration and moisture balance.
  • Light: Filtered or bright indirect light; acclimate slowly to full sun as it matures.
  • Humidity: Loves humidity — mist foliage or use a humidifier indoors.
  • Pruning: Minimal; remove crossing or shaded interior branches to keep the trunk visible and the canopy airy.

💧 Water & Feeding

  • Water: Jaboticabas love consistent moisture — water daily in warm weather.
  • Fertilizer: Use a balanced organic fertilizer in spring and mid-summer.
  • Top Dressing: Compost or worm castings once per year.
  • pH Maintenance: Maintain 5.5–6.5; amend with pine bark or elemental sulfur if needed.

🌿 Seasonal Habits

  • Evergreen in Florida; may briefly drop leaves during cold or drought.
  • New growth appears bronze, maturing to glossy green.
  • Once mature, may flower and fruit several times per year after rains or irrigation flushes.

🌾 Troubleshooting Guide

1️⃣ Yellow Leaves / Chlorosis

→ High pH or hard water. Fix with acidic mix and chelated iron.

2️⃣ Leaf Curl / Burn

→ Drought or intense sun. Provide filtered light and steady moisture.

3️⃣ Slow Growth

→ Normal in early years; consistency is key — acidic soil, filtered light, and patience.

4️⃣ Root Rot

→ Soggy soil or poor drainage. Use airy media and drain pots well.

5️⃣ Scale / Sooty Mold

→ Sap feeders. Wipe leaves, apply horticultural oil, improve airflow.

6️⃣ Fruit Splitting (later years)

→ Uneven watering. Maintain steady soil moisture.

🍃 FAQ

How old is this plant?2–3 years old.

When will it fruit? Usually within 2–4 years, making it the fastest-fruiting jaboticaba we grow.

Will it stay small? No — it grows slowly but steadily, eventually forming a full-sized tree.

Container or in-ground? Both possible; containers perform best for pH and moisture control.

How often should I water? Daily or as needed to keep soil evenly moist.

Full sun or shade? Filtered or dappled light is best; full sun only once mature and acclimated.
